     Went for a nice 12 mile run this morning up past the reservoir. The temps were nice and there wasn't any wind when I ran [it's very windy now]. The ice was completely gone as of last Saturday and the loons that show up every spring are back. I love hearing there calls on a quiet morning. I kept a comfortable pace for most of the run then ran the last 3 miles at around 7:10-7:15 which I counted as MP. 7:45 Overall pace.

     The past 4 mornings I have woken up with my right hip sore.  It has gone away once I start running but was much more sore yesterday morning. Once I got a couple of miles into yesterdays run it completely went away. It was just as sore this morning so I decided I wouldn't run and rode my mt bike instead. It has always been my left hip that has given me trouble in the past so this is a first. I went 20 miles on the bike. It was a nice morning.

     My hip pain was much lower this morning so I decided to try a short easy run. I felt very little pain during and after the run but the last 2 times I ran it felt fine until that evening when it started to hurt and then was quite painful by morning.I guess I'll have to wait and see how it goes this time. 5 miles @ 8:24 AP.
